No internships inside the college. IT and CS have the highest placement. Salary varies according to the branch and the CGPA. For mechanical the salary package averages between 2 lakhs to 3 lakhs per annum. In every branch out of the no. of people sitting for placement more than 60% get placed. The alumni network is very strong and several interactive sessions are held regularly.
There is one hostel inside the campus and it's not that huge and generally, no one stays at the hostel as all the students come from nearby areas. Pg options vary and so does the price. There are hostels in the vicinity of college too. The food at the canteen is pure veg and on an average will cost you INR 50 to 70. Classrooms are big and can seat 80 students comfortably. No wifi for students. Labs are resourceful and the library has an abundance of books of every branch and year.
The eligibility criteria for SIES GST is strictly based on the marks scored in MAH CET. The cutoff typically ranges from 120+ marks in MAH CET.
The Daily routine is pretty well organized and it varies from year to year. Teaching is really good and the staff encourages participation in extracurricular activities. Overall experience is pretty great
INR 1lakh to INR 1.2 lakhs per annum or INR 10,000 or INR 20,000 per annum depending on your caste and other factors. Scholarships are often awarded to students with low income based on merit. Loans may be needed depending on the financial situation of the student. The loan amount is easy to get from any bank.
There are lots of student societies active in our college like EDC, SAE, IETE, CSI etc. There are literature clubs, music clubs, theatre, dance etc. There are 2 main fests that happen once every academic year cognition (tech fest) and TML (cultural fest). Life in college is pretty chilled and fun
